AHA Releases Report on Cardiovascular Health of the Nation

The American Heart Association has released a compendium of statistics about the nation's cardiovascular health in Circulation. Among the highlights:

  • In 2004, women consumed an average of 22% more calories per day than they did in 1971, and men consumed 10% more.
  • A third of adults do not undertake any physical activity.
  • Cardiovascular mortality fell 31% from 1998 to 2008, possibly because of improved treatment options.
  • Nonetheless, one in every three U.S. deaths in 2008 could be attributed to cardiovascular disease.
